Battery Options

For maximum dependability, whats the best type of battery to get? mine has died 2x, b/c i'll be playing my stereo on the "on" option. but engine isnt runnning. whats powerfull enough to just get a good battery and not a cap for my system?

I heard the Optima battery was really good. Don't have one myself, just know people who do. You can mount it any way because it has gel inside instead of water. Also has different color tops if that matters to you. Only down side is it's kinda on the expensive side.
